Tomato Hot Dish Recipe

Ingredients:

1 lb ground beef plus 1 tbsp oil

1 small onion diced

1 can whole kernel corn drained

1-2 cans tomato soup

1-2 cans water

2 cups cooked macaroni

Parmesan cheese sprinkle on top

Salt and pepper to taste

Directions:

Cook ground beef add diced onion cook until done
Put in casserole dish
Add corn, cooked macaroni, tomato soup, and water
Mix all ingredients together sprinkle with Parmesan cheese on top season with salt and pepper to taste
Bake 350º for 30-40 minutes
